I just ordered four tires from Diamondback located in South Carolina, shipping to NW Ohio...$140 FED-X Ground. Cost must be in the weight of the rims.
-
The price difference might be in the packaging. Typically tires aren't shipped in a box, since they really don't need to be protected. Whereas, tires and rims need to be in a box, with packaging around them, so that they don't get banged up by stuff being thrown on top of them, etc.
